Position Description
Responsible for working with families who have children enrolled in the Early Intervention program. Provide families with information, support and assistance; and work closely with the therapists and Service Coordination, to ensure the child's and family's needs are clearly identified and services found to meet those needs. Reports to the Associate Director of Early Intervention.
Job Responsibilities - Highlights
- Explore family concerns, resources, and priorities and support the achievement of children and family outcomes.
- Discuss with family and other professionals the family's strengths, concerns, priorities and desired outcomes.
- Link family with appropriate services and resources as indicated on IFSP.
- Coordinate services with other agencies and provide crisis intervention as needed.
- Maintain accurate records for a fee-for-service system and complete all necessary paperwork as required.
- Act as a referral source for inquiries regarding services for children with developmental delays and disabilities.
- Performs other related duties as assigned. Duties, responsibilities, and activities may change at any time with or without notice.
